Can anyone confirm for me plz. Was the Doctor BB shouted at M or F?Ben Butler, 36, who was sitting in the glass-walled dock at the Old Bailey in London, lost his temper while a consultant paediatric pathologist from St Thomas hospital gave evidence about Ellies postmortem.
Andreas Marnerides was being asked by the defence about the cremation of Ellie after her death in October 2013.
When barrister Di Middleton asked whether the cremation was carried out in consultation with the defendants solicitors, Butler began screaming: No, no, no, no, it wasnt.
"Through the glass he shouted at the doctor: How dare you. You took samples and cremated her behind our back.
Ellies mother, Jennifer Gray, who has been charged with a separate offence relating to treatment of the child, joined in on the attack on the doctor shouting: How dare you.
Butler then stormed out of the dock shouting: You hid evidence ... yeah, yeah, yeah, you hid evidence."
